Miami’s 2026 recruiting class is coming down the home stretch.


The class currently stands at 23 verbal commitments, ranked #12

in the nation and #1 in the ACC. And the Canes want more and are not finished.


ree

On Tuesday, news broke that four-star jumbo wide receiver Milan Parris (Stow, OH - Walsh Jesuit) de-committed from Iowa State. Miami has been pushing hard for Parris and this news could indicate the Canes are making real progress here. However, there are several other schools also pursuing Parris.


If Miami is the leader in this recruitment, it then presents another dilemma. The Canes also badly want to flip 5-star local wide receiver Calvin Russell (Miami, FL - Northwestern) from Syracuse. Would Miami take five wide receivers in this cycle? The answer is YES. The departure of three wide receivers (CJ Daniels, Tony Johnson, Keelan Marion) after this season and potential transfers, Miami could face another major overhaul of that room.



There is another possible option. IF, a big if, the Canes are able land both Russell and Parris, they could consider moving Parris to tight end down the road. Parris would need some time in Miami’s strength & conditioning program, but he has the size and the frame to add more mass. Currently, Parris stands at 6’-5.5”/205 with a 6'-9" wing span. And he’s a willing and capable blocker. Add 25-30 pounds and you would have another dynamic weapon for Miami’s future offense.
